آموزش بهینه سازی فایل Robots.txt و نقشه سایت (Sitemap)

آموزش بهینه سازی فایل Robots.txt

مقدمه: چرا Robots.txt و Sitemap برای سئو حیاتی هستند؟

در دنیای بهینه سازی سئو سایت، فایل‌های Robots.txt و Sitemap دو ابزار حیاتی هستند که اغلب نادیده گرفته می‌شوند. این فایل‌ها به خزنده‌های گوگل کمک می‌کنند تا سایت شما را به شکل مؤثرتری بررسی و ایندکس کنند. اما چگونه می‌توان این فایل‌ها را بهینه کرد تا رتبه بهتری در نتایج جستجو کسب کرد؟ در این راهنما، به بررسی جامع این دو ابزار و نحوه استفاده بهینه از آن‌ها می‌پردازیم.

Robots.txt چیست و چه کاربردی دارد؟

Robots.txt یک فایل متنی ساده است که در ریشه دامنه شما قرار می‌گیرد. این فایل به خزنده‌های موتورهای جستجو (مانند ربات گوگل) دستور می‌دهد که کدام بخش‌های سایت شما نباید بررسی و ایندکس شوند. این کار به دلایل مختلفی می‌تواند مفید باشد، از جمله:

  • جلوگیری از ایندکس شدن صفحات تکراری یا کم‌ارزش
  • محافظت از بخش‌های خصوصی سایت (مانند صفحات ورود کاربران)
  • مدیریت بودجه خزش (Crawl Budget) گوگل

Syntax فایل Robots.txt

یک فایل Robots.txt از دستورالعمل‌های ساده‌ای تشکیل شده است. مهم‌ترین دستورالعمل‌ها عبارتند از:

  • User-agent: مشخص می‌کند که این دستورالعمل برای کدام خزنده اعمال می‌شود.
  • Disallow: مشخص می‌کند که کدام مسیرها نباید بررسی شوند.
  • Allow: (اختیاری) مشخص می‌کند که کدام مسیرها با وجود Disallow باید بررسی شوند.
  • Sitemap: (اختیاری) آدرس نقشه سایت شما را مشخص می‌کند.

مثال:

text
User-agent: *
Disallow: /admin/
Disallow: /tmp/

Sitemap: https://example.com/sitemap.xml

این فایل به همه خزنده‌ها می‌گوید که پوشه‌های /admin/ و /tmp/ را بررسی نکنند و آدرس نقشه سایت در https://example.com/sitemap.xml قرار دارد.

الگوریتم‌های گوگل و تأثیر Robots.txt

PageRank: مدیریت بودجه خزش

با جلوگیری از خزش صفحات بی‌اهمیت، می‌توانید بودجه خزش گوگل را به صفحات مهم‌تر اختصاص دهید و در نتیجه PageRank را بهینه‌سازی کنید.

READ
سئو سایت فروشگاهی کالاهای لوکس: جذب مشتریان خاص با تکنیک‌های حرفه‌ای

Google Panda: جلوگیری از ایندکس صفحات تکراری

Panda به محتوای تکراری حساس است. با استفاده از Robots.txt می‌توانید از ایندکس شدن صفحات تکراری جلوگیری کرده و از جریمه Panda در امان بمانید.

Google Penguin: جلوگیری از خزش لینک‌های بی‌کیفیت

با مسدود کردن دسترسی خزنده‌ها به صفحات دارای لینک‌های اسپم، می‌توانید از تأثیر منفی Penguin جلوگیری کنید.

Hummingbird و BERT: تمرکز بر محتوای اصلی

با جلوگیری از خزش صفحات بی‌ارزش، می‌توانید تمرکز Hummingbird و BERT را بر محتوای اصلی و ارزشمند سایت خود افزایش دهید.

Caffeine Indexing System: بهینه‌سازی سرعت ایندکس

با بهینه‌سازی Robots.txt، می‌توانید فرآیند ایندکس Caffeine Indexing System را تسریع کنید.

Sitemap چیست و چه کاربردی دارد؟

Sitemap یک فایل XML است که لیستی از تمام صفحات مهم سایت شما را در بر می‌گیرد. این فایل به خزنده‌های موتورهای جستجو کمک می‌کند تا به سرعت و به طور کامل تمام صفحات سایت شما را پیدا و ایندکس کنند. Sitemap شامل اطلاعاتی مانند:

  • آدرس URL صفحه
  • آخرین زمان به‌روزرسانی صفحه
  • میزان اهمیت صفحه نسبت به سایر صفحات سایت
  • فرکانس تغییرات صفحه

Syntax فایل Sitemap

یک فایل Sitemap از تگ‌های XML خاصی تشکیل شده است. مهم‌ترین تگ‌ها عبارتند از:

  • <urlset>: تگ اصلی که تمام اطلاعات Sitemap را در بر می‌گیرد.
  • <url>: تگی که اطلاعات مربوط به یک صفحه را در بر می‌گیرد.
  • <loc>: آدرس URL صفحه.
  • <lastmod>: آخرین زمان به‌روزرسانی صفحه (فرمت: YYYY-MM-DD).
  • <priority>: میزان اهمیت صفحه (مقدار بین 0.0 تا 1.0).
  • <changefreq>: فرکانس تغییرات صفحه (مقادیر: always, hourly, daily, weekly, monthly, yearly, never).

مثال:

xml
<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
  <url>
    <loc>https://example.com/</loc>
    <lastmod>2023-10-26</lastmod>
    <priority>1.0</priority>
    <changefreq>daily</changefreq>
  </url>
  <url>
    <loc>https://example.com/about/</loc>
    <lastmod>2023-10-26</lastmod>
    <priority>0.8</priority>
    <changefreq>monthly</changefreq>
  </url>
</urlset>

الگوریتم‌های گوگل و تأثیر Sitemap

Caffeine Indexing System: تسریع ایندکس

Sitemap به Caffeine Indexing System کمک می‌کند تا به سرعت و به طور کامل تمام صفحات سایت شما را ایندکس کند.

READ
بهترین دایرکتوری‌ها و فروم‌های ایرانی برای ثبت و دریافت بک لینک معتبر

RankBrain: درک ساختار سایت

با ارائه یک ساختار واضح از سایت، Sitemap به RankBrain کمک می‌کند تا روابط بین صفحات مختلف را بهتر درک کند.

Mobilegeddon: ایندکس صفحات موبایل

با اطمینان از اینکه تمام صفحات موبایل شما در Sitemap قرار دارند، می‌توانید Mobilegeddon را بهینه‌سازی کنید.

E-E-A-T: بهبود اعتبار سایت

Sitemap به گوگل کمک می‌کند تا ساختار و محتوای سایت شما را بهتر درک کند، که می‌تواند به بهبود E-E-A-T کمک کند.

نکات عملی برای بهینه سازی Robots.txt

  1. فایل را در ریشه دامنه قرار دهید: فایل Robots.txt باید در ریشه دامنه شما قرار داشته باشد (مثلاً https://example.com/robots.txt).
  2. از دستورالعمل‌های دقیق استفاده کنید: از دستورالعمل‌های دقیق و واضح برای مسدود کردن صفحات استفاده کنید.
  3. از مسدود کردن صفحات مهم خودداری کنید: از مسدود کردن صفحات مهمی که می‌خواهید در نتایج جستجو ظاهر شوند، خودداری کنید.
  4. از ابزارهای تست استفاده کنید: از ابزارهای تست Robots.txt مانند Google Search Console برای بررسی صحت فایل خود استفاده کنید.
  5. به طور منظم فایل را بررسی کنید: به طور منظم فایل Robots.txt خود را بررسی کنید و در صورت نیاز آن را به‌روزرسانی کنید.

نکات عملی برای بهینه سازی Sitemap

  1. تمام صفحات مهم را در Sitemap قرار دهید: تمام صفحات مهم سایت خود را در Sitemap قرار دهید.
  2. Sitemap را به Google Search Console ارسال کنید: Sitemap خود را به Google Search Console ارسال کنید تا گوگل بتواند به راحتی آن را پیدا کند.
  3. Sitemap را در Robots.txt ذکر کنید: آدرس Sitemap خود را در فایل Robots.txt ذکر کنید.
  4. از Sitemapهای متعدد استفاده کنید: اگر سایت بزرگی دارید، از Sitemapهای متعدد استفاده کنید.
  5. Sitemap را به‌روز نگه دارید: Sitemap خود را با هر بار به‌روزرسانی محتوای سایت خود، به‌روز نگه دارید.
  6. اولویت‌بندی صفحات: با استفاده از تگ <priority>، میزان اهمیت صفحات مختلف را برای خزنده‌های گوگل مشخص کنید.
  7. تعیین فرکانس تغییرات: با استفاده از تگ <changefreq>، به گوگل اطلاع دهید که هر چند وقت یک بار محتوای صفحات شما تغییر می‌کند.
  8. تست و اعتبارسنجی: قبل از ارسال Sitemap به گوگل، از ابزارهای آنلاین برای تست و اعتبارسنجی آن استفاده کنید.
READ
سئو سایت حقوقی | افزایش اعتبار و دیده شدن کسب‌وکار شما

ابزارهای مفید

  • Google Search Console: برای تست Robots.txt و ارسال Sitemap.
  • Robots.txt Tester: ابزاری آنلاین برای تست فایل Robots.txt.
  • XML Sitemap Validator: ابزاری آنلاین برای اعتبارسنجی فایل Sitemap.

اشتباهات رایج و نحوه اجتناب از آن‌ها

  • مسدود کردن تمام سایت در Robots.txt: این اشتباه رایج می‌تواند باعث شود که هیچ‌کدام از صفحات سایت شما در نتایج جستجو ظاهر نشوند.
  • عدم استفاده از Sitemap: عدم استفاده از Sitemap می‌تواند باعث شود که گوگل نتواند تمام صفحات سایت شما را پیدا کند.
  • عدم به‌روزرسانی Sitemap: عدم به‌روزرسانی Sitemap می‌تواند باعث شود که گوگل اطلاعات قدیمی از سایت شما داشته باشد.
  • بی‌توجهی به خطاهای Sitemap: بی‌توجهی به خطاهای موجود در Sitemap می‌تواند باعث شود که گوگل نتواند آن را به درستی پردازش کند.

تاثیر به‌روزرسانی هسته گوگل

Broad Core Algorithm Updates (به‌روزرسانی‌های هسته اصلی الگوریتم) نیز می‌توانند تأثیر مستقیمی بر نحوه ایندکس و رتبه‌بندی سایت شما داشته باشند. با بهینه‌سازی مستمر Robots.txt و Sitemap، می‌توانید اطمینان حاصل کنید که سایت شما با جدیدترین تغییرات الگوریتم گوگل سازگار است.

نتیجه‌گیری

بهینه سازی فایل Robots.txt و Sitemap دو جزء اساسی در بهینه سازی سئو سایت هستند. با استفاده صحیح از این ابزارها، می‌توانید به موتورهای جستجو کمک کنید تا سایت شما را بهتر بررسی و ایندکس کنند و در نتیجه رتبه بهتری در نتایج جستجو کسب کنید. به‌یاد داشته باشید که این فرآیند نیازمند بررسی و به‌روزرسانی مداوم است تا با تغییرات الگوریتم‌های گوگل هماهنگ باشد.

0 0 رای ها
Article Rating
اشتراک در
اطلاع از
guest
0 Comments
بیشترین رأی
تازه‌ترین قدیمی‌ترین
بازخورد (Feedback) های اینلاین
مشاهده همه دیدگاه ها
درباره نویسنده

مرتضی جعفری، نویسنده و تحلیلگر سئو، به کسب‌وکارها کمک می‌کند تا از طریق بهینه‌سازی هوشمندانه برای موتورهای جستجو، به نتایج ملموس و افزایش بازگشت سرمایه دست یابند. او با تمرکز بر استراتژی‌های سئوی فنی، محتوایی و لینک‌سازی، مقالاتی عمیق و عملی ارائه می‌دهد که مستقیماً به بهبود رتبه و افزایش ترافیک ارگانیک شما کمک می‌کنند. اگر به دنبال راهکارهای اثبات‌شده برای رشد در فضای آنلاین هستید، مقالات سایت بازاراینا راهنمای شما خواهد بود.”

جدیدترین مطالب

آیا باید اعتبار سایت خود را بالا ببرید؟

ما یک راه حل ایده آل برای بازاریابی تجاری شما داریم.

ارسال نظر و ارتباط با ما

آیا می خواهید ارتباط مستقیم با تیم ما داشته باشید؟

نظرات خود را برای ما ارسال کنید، یا اینکه اگر سوالی دارید به صورت 24 ساعت آماده پاسخگویی به شما هستیم :)

همین امروز وبسایت خود را ارتقا دهید!

مشاوره تخصصی 24 ساعته، یکبار امتحان کنید و نتیجه آن را ببینید!!!

جهت بررسی و تجزیه و تحلیل رایگان سیستم بازاریابی سایت شما، ایملتان را وارد کنید.

0
افکار شما را دوست داریم، لطفا نظر دهید.x